Transaction 56bdb5dd85f8b79244c70253fe38c8ae270f67009a61c1073eab39e38e42bde4

5 Input
1 Outputs
  • 56bdb5dd85f8b79244c70253fe38c8ae270f67009a61c1073eab39e38e42bde4:0
  • value  435159
    address  bc1qy444gxljute0l5j2hza4sg60w9vwuhglenk8al